Tom Collins Cocktail

Cultural Context

The Tom Collins is a classic cocktail that dates back to the 19th century, originating in England. Named after a practical joke that was popular at the time, it has become a staple in cocktail culture, celebrated for its refreshing blend of gin, lemon, and soda. Today, the Tom Collins is enjoyed worldwide, often served at gatherings and summer parties, embodying the spirit of conviviality and relaxation.

Servings4
2 oz gin
0.5 oz simple syrup
0.75 oz lemon juice
2 oz soda water
ice
lemon twist
maraschino cherry
1

Add 2 oz of gin to a cocktail shaker.

2

Add 0.5 oz of simple syrup to the shaker.

3

Add 0.75 oz of lemon juice to the shaker.

4

Add ice to the shaker.

5

Shake for 10 to 12 seconds.

6

Add 2 oz of soda water to the shaker.

7

Strain over fresh ice into a glass.

8

Garnish with a lemon twist and a maraschino cherry.
